'Holarrhena antidysenterica' definitions:

Definition of 'Holarrhena antidysenterica'

(from WordNet)
noun
Tropical Asian tree with hard white wood and bark formerly used as a remedy for dysentery and diarrhea [syn: ivory tree, conessi, kurchi, kurchee, Holarrhena pubescens, Holarrhena antidysenterica]
